Transaction f841336a0300ddd25c648ad58878e4571a8127aed6fb254654f93757c2bc0a74
1 Input
1 Output
-
f841336a0300ddd25c648ad58878e4571a8127aed6fb254654f93757c2bc0a74:0
- value
- 116898905
- script pubkey
- OP_0 OP_PUSHBYTES_20 43f7d08b84105bfcd86012dc66cfea980f76c5e2
- address
- bc1qg0mapzuyzpdlekrqztwxdnl2nq8hd30z06wgr8